How much do net core developer j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 19, 2026, the average hourly pay for net core developer in Maryland is $52.15,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$45.05 and $59.47 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a .NET Core developer?

A .NET Core Developer is responsible for building and maintaining applications using the .NET Core framework, a cross-platform, open-source development framework from Microsoft. They specialize in backend development, working with C#, ASP.NET Core, and related technologies to create efficient, scalable, and secure applications. Their role includes designing APIs, integrating databases, ensuring application performance, and collaborating with frontend developers and other stakeholders.

What are the typical daily responsibilities of a .NET Core developer?

As a Net Core Developer, your daily tasks often include designing, coding, and testing scalable web applications using C# and the .NET Core framework. You may also participate in code reviews, collaborate with cross-functional teams such as UI/UX designers and QA engineers, and troubleshoot production issues. Additionally, you might be responsible for integrating third-party APIs, maintaining application documentation, and ensuring that deployments run smoothly. This role generally involves a mix of independent coding work and active team collaboration, with frequent opportunities to contribute to architectural decisions and process improvements.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a .NET Core developer?

To thrive as a Net Core Developer, you need proficiency in C#, ASP.NET Core, and object-oriented programming, alongside a bachelor’s degree in computer science or a related field. Familiarity with version control systems like Git, cloud platforms such as Azure or AWS, and relevant certifications (like Microsoft Certified: .NET Developer) can be highly beneficial. Strong analytical thinking, problem-solving skills, and effective communication are crucial for collaborating within development teams and interacting with stakeholders. These skills and qualities are essential for delivering robust, efficient, and maintainable software solutions in dynamic technical environments.
